A comment today from Dick Cavett in the New York Times: Watching my old shows, the odd sensation about it is, there I am sitting with Lucille Ball or someone like that, and it is overlain by the thought, "One of us is dead." "So far it's always the other one."

  10. I visited the Nobel Museum in Sweden, Mann's 1929 citation mentions his shorter stories more than his novels. He was one of leading German exile from National Socialist Germany. Hitler set his books on fire.
  11. Mann's novella 'Death in Venice' has a gay story line. The novella became a successful movie, later an opera and later a full- length German ballet.
